Default [IBC] Epsom Salt and Fertilizers

I agree with Billy, it is better to underdose than overdose, but I've always done the Epsom Salt thing another way. Herb Gustafson once told me to just sprinkle it on like I was seasoning meat on my BBQ. So, a couple times a season I do. When I water, the salts dissolve, and that's that. Simple. I've got enough mixing to do with just my regular fertilization, I don't need any more and Herb's method works.
